The Impact of Truant and Alcohol-Related Behavior on Educational Aspirations: A Study of US High School Seniors*

To ensure that adolescents further their education and maximize their potential life opportunities, school and public health officials should initiate efforts to reduce alcohol consumption and truancy among students. Furthermore, future research should examine the risk and protective factors that may influence one's educational aspirations.
